    Drinking Water Intake of Adult Residents in Chengguan District of Lanzhou

    • Objectives To acquire the drinking water intake of adult residents in Chengguan district, and to provide the scientific basis for health risk assessment on drinking water intake of residents in Chengguan district of Lanzhou.
      Methods A total of 260 healthy permanent residents over 18 years old were selected by cluster random sampling from Chengguan district in Lanzhou in July and December of 2017. The information on drinking water intake of residents was investigated by using quantitative measurement and questionnaire survey. Wilcoxon rank sum test and Kruskal-Wallis rank sum test were used for statistical analysis of drinking water intake.
      Results The median of total drinking water intake, direct drinking water intake, and indirect drinking water intake of residents in Chengguan district were 2 043, 1 600, and 395 mL/d, respectively. The total drinking water intake, direct drinking water intake, and indirect drinking water intake of males (2 277, 1 800, and 432 mL/d) were all higher than that of females (1 973, 1 500, and 354 mL/d) (P < 0.05); and the total drinking water intake and direct drinking water intake of males in summer and winter were all higher than that of females (P < 0.05). The total drinking water intake could be ranked from the highest to the lowest as 2 150 mL/d (18~44 years old), 2 042 mL/d (45~64 years old), and 1 878 mL/d (over 65 years old) (P < 0.05). However, there was no statistically significant difference for direct and indirect drinking water intake of different age groups.
      Conclusions This investigation acquired information of drinking water intake of residents in Chengguan district of Lanzhou and provided basic reference for carrying out health risk assessment of drinking water in local areas.
